Features

AirPillow Cushion: Inflates gently on inhale and relaxes on exhale for a soft yet stable seal. Quiet Exhale: Cloth diffuser mutes airflow sound and reduces draft toward bed partners. Minimalist Frame: Open design avoids claustrophobia and supports side and stomach sleepers. Adjustable Headgear: Velcro tabs and split-tail strap offer a snug, secure fit. Short Swivel Tube: Lets you change sleep positions more freely without hose drag. No Magnetic Clips: Compatible with medical implants and metal-sensitive users.

Compatibility & Setup
  • Works with most CPAP machines via standard hose
  • Requires Zephair adapter for ResMed AirMini compatibility
  • Choose XS/S or M/L nasal pillow size based on fit
  • Contains no magnets

Specifications
Product Model Brevida
Vendor Product Number 400BRE131
Materials Frame: Polycarbonate Elbow: Polycarbonate Swivel: Polycarbonate Seal: Silicone/Polycarbonate Headgear: Lycra / Polyurethane Foam Laminate Headgear Clips: Acetal Diffuser: Polyester Fiber/Polycarbonate (PC) Tube: Polypropylene (PP)
Tax Category CPAP Replacement Supplies
Billing Code A7034 (Mask)
Product Life 6 - 12 Months

FAQs about the Brevida Nasal Pillow CPAP Mask

What’s the difference between the brevida and the Pilairo Q?

Both the Brevida and Pilairo Q are adjustable and ultra-quiet. The main difference between the two masks is that the Brevida has a smaller profile and is lighter than the Pilairo Q. You can read more about the similarities and differences between these two masks.

What’s the difference between the brevida versus the P10?

As discussed on our blog, the key difference between the Brevida and the AirFit P10 is the headgear. The Brevida and AirFit P10 both have the same single-strap elastic headgear except the Brevida headgear can be fully adjusted using the extendable Velcro on each side.

Is the brevida compatible with any CPAP machine?

Yes, thanks to its standard tubing, the Brevida Nasal Pillow Mask can be used with any CPAP machine. To use the Brevida with ResMed's AirMini Travel CPAP, you'll need the Zephair Hose Adapter.

Can I replace the brevida nasal pillow CPAP mask?

Absolutely! For optimal performance and hygiene, we recommend replacing your Brevida nasal pillows every three to six months. You can learn more about changing out your mask here.

Can I use the brevida nasal pillow mask if I am a side sleeper?

Outfitted with a short tube and swivel, the Brevida offers increased mobility for side sleepers and active sleepers alike.

Can I use the brevida nasal pillow mask if I have facial hair?

Those with mustaches may not find the fit of the Brevida as comfortable as those without a mustache due to where the mask rests. Check out our recommendations for facial hair friendly masks here.
